    2015 is a big year for Valli Opticians, and April is a particularly big month in which we turned ten years old. On the 5th April 2005, Moin and Rachel Valli laid the foundation of what has become a countywide business. Valli Opticians began with the purchase of three optical practices in the Huddersfield area.     Valli Optometrist and Regional Youth Volunteer, Kamal Aftab has been involved in a tree planting ceremony at Butterley reservoir near Marsden last weekend. Butterley reservoir is undergoing huge restoration work, which is being carried out by Yorkshire Water after over three centuries of use.
